diff options
Diffstat (limited to 'src/mainboard/iwill')
-rw-r--r-- | src/mainboard/iwill/Kconfig | 17 | ||||
-rw-r--r-- | src/mainboard/iwill/dk8_htx/Kconfig | 26 | ||||
-rw-r--r-- | src/mainboard/iwill/dk8s2/Kconfig | 24 | ||||
-rw-r--r-- | src/mainboard/iwill/dk8x/Kconfig | 23 |
4 files changed, 32 insertions, 58 deletions
diff --git a/src/mainboard/iwill/Kconfig b/src/mainboard/iwill/Kconfig index 4a157954ab..c520138818 100644 --- a/src/mainboard/iwill/Kconfig +++ b/src/mainboard/iwill/Kconfig @@ -1,10 +1,23 @@ +if VENDOR_IWILL + choice prompt "Mainboard model" - depends on VENDOR_IWILL + +config BOARD_IWILL_DK8_HTX + bool "DK8-HTX" +config BOARD_IWILL_DK8S2 + bool "DK8S2" +config BOARD_IWILL_DK8X + bool "DK8X" + +endchoice source "src/mainboard/iwill/dk8_htx/Kconfig" source "src/mainboard/iwill/dk8s2/Kconfig" source "src/mainboard/iwill/dk8x/Kconfig" -endchoice +config MAINBOARD_VENDOR + string + default "IWILL" +endif # VENDOR_IWILL diff --git a/src/mainboard/iwill/dk8_htx/Kconfig b/src/mainboard/iwill/dk8_htx/Kconfig index 1b425f6b6b..eebfef5544 100644 --- a/src/mainboard/iwill/dk8_htx/Kconfig +++ b/src/mainboard/iwill/dk8_htx/Kconfig @@ -1,5 +1,7 @@ -config BOARD_IWILL_DK8_HTX - bool "DK8-HTX" +if BOARD_IWILL_DK8_HTX + +config BOARD_SPECIFIC_OPTIONS # dummy + def_bool y select ARCH_X86 select CPU_AMD_SOCKET_940 select NORTHBRIDGE_AMD_AMDK8 @@ -23,89 +25,73 @@ config BOARD_IWILL_DK8_HTX config MAINBOARD_DIR string default iwill/dk8_htx - depends on BOARD_IWILL_DK8_HTX config DCACHE_RAM_BASE hex default 0xc8000 - depends on BOARD_IWILL_DK8_HTX config DCACHE_RAM_SIZE hex default 0x08000 - depends on BOARD_IWILL_DK8_HTX config DCACHE_RAM_GLOBAL_VAR_SIZE hex default 0x01000 - depends on BOARD_IWILL_DK8_HTX config APIC_ID_OFFSET hex default 0x10 - depends on BOARD_IWILL_DK8_HTX config MAINBOARD_PART_NUMBER string default "DK8-HTX" - depends on BOARD_IWILL_DK8_HTX config HW_MEM_HOLE_SIZEK hex default 0x100000 - depends on BOARD_IWILL_DK8_HTX config MAX_CPUS int default 4 - depends on BOARD_IWILL_DK8_HTX config MAX_PHYSICAL_CPUS int default 2 - depends on BOARD_IWILL_DK8_HTX config HW_MEM_HOLE_SIZE_AUTO_INC bool default n - depends on BOARD_IWILL_DK8_HTX config SB_HT_CHAIN_ON_BUS0 int default 2 - depends on BOARD_IWILL_DK8_HTX config HT_CHAIN_END_UNITID_BASE hex default 0x6 - depends on BOARD_IWILL_DK8_HTX config HT_CHAIN_UNITID_BASE hex default 0xa - depends on BOARD_IWILL_DK8_HTX config SERIAL_CPU_INIT bool default n - depends on BOARD_IWILL_DK8_HTX config IRQ_SLOT_COUNT int default 11 - depends on BOARD_IWILL_DK8_HTX config MAINBOARD_PCI_SUBSYSTEM_VENDOR_ID hex default 0x1022 - depends on BOARD_IWILL_DK8_HTX config MAINBOARD_PCI_SUBSYSTEM_DEVICE_ID hex default 0x2b80 - depends on BOARD_IWILL_DK8_HTX config ACPI_SSDTX_NUM int default 5 - depends on BOARD_IWILL_DK8_HTX + +endif # BOARD_IWILL_DK8_HTX diff --git a/src/mainboard/iwill/dk8s2/Kconfig b/src/mainboard/iwill/dk8s2/Kconfig index 10d525acfa..ee88bd375f 100644 --- a/src/mainboard/iwill/dk8s2/Kconfig +++ b/src/mainboard/iwill/dk8s2/Kconfig @@ -1,5 +1,7 @@ -config BOARD_IWILL_DK8S2 - bool "DK8S2" +if BOARD_IWILL_DK8S2 + +config BOARD_SPECIFIC_OPTIONS # dummy + def_bool y select ARCH_X86 select CPU_AMD_SOCKET_940 select NORTHBRIDGE_AMD_AMDK8 @@ -20,85 +22,69 @@ config BOARD_IWILL_DK8S2 config MAINBOARD_DIR string default iwill/dk8s2 - depends on BOARD_IWILL_DK8S2 config DCACHE_RAM_BASE hex default 0xc8000 - depends on BOARD_IWILL_DK8S2 config DCACHE_RAM_SIZE hex default 0x08000 - depends on BOARD_IWILL_DK8S2 config DCACHE_RAM_GLOBAL_VAR_SIZE hex default 0x01000 - depends on BOARD_IWILL_DK8S2 config APIC_ID_OFFSET hex default 0x0 - depends on BOARD_IWILL_DK8S2 config MAINBOARD_PART_NUMBER string default "DK8S2" - depends on BOARD_IWILL_DK8S2 config HW_MEM_HOLE_SIZEK hex default 0x100000 - depends on BOARD_IWILL_DK8S2 config MAX_CPUS int default 2 - depends on BOARD_IWILL_DK8S2 config MAX_PHYSICAL_CPUS int default 2 - depends on BOARD_IWILL_DK8S2 config HW_MEM_HOLE_SIZE_AUTO_INC bool default n - depends on BOARD_IWILL_DK8S2 config SB_HT_CHAIN_ON_BUS0 int default 0 - depends on BOARD_IWILL_DK8S2 config HT_CHAIN_END_UNITID_BASE hex default 0x20 - depends on BOARD_IWILL_DK8S2 config HT_CHAIN_UNITID_BASE hex default 0x1 - depends on BOARD_IWILL_DK8S2 config SERIAL_CPU_INIT bool default n - depends on BOARD_IWILL_DK8S2 config IRQ_SLOT_COUNT int default 12 - depends on BOARD_IWILL_DK8S2 config MAINBOARD_PCI_SUBSYSTEM_VENDOR_ID hex default 0x161f - depends on BOARD_IWILL_DK8S2 config MAINBOARD_PCI_SUBSYSTEM_DEVICE_ID hex default 0x3016 - depends on BOARD_IWILL_DK8S2 +endif # BOARD_IWILL_DK8S2 diff --git a/src/mainboard/iwill/dk8x/Kconfig b/src/mainboard/iwill/dk8x/Kconfig index 184edc062d..652ff1beb6 100644 --- a/src/mainboard/iwill/dk8x/Kconfig +++ b/src/mainboard/iwill/dk8x/Kconfig @@ -1,5 +1,7 @@ -config BOARD_IWILL_DK8X - bool "DK8X" +if BOARD_IWILL_DK8X + +config BOARD_SPECIFIC_OPTIONS # dummy + def_bool y select ARCH_X86 select CPU_AMD_SOCKET_940 select NORTHBRIDGE_AMD_AMDK8 @@ -19,74 +21,61 @@ config BOARD_IWILL_DK8X config MAINBOARD_DIR string default iwill/dk8x - depends on BOARD_IWILL_DK8X config DCACHE_RAM_BASE hex default 0xc8000 - depends on BOARD_IWILL_DK8X config DCACHE_RAM_SIZE hex default 0x08000 - depends on BOARD_IWILL_DK8X config DCACHE_RAM_GLOBAL_VAR_SIZE hex default 0x01000 - depends on BOARD_IWILL_DK8X config APIC_ID_OFFSET hex default 0x0 - depends on BOARD_IWILL_DK8X config MAINBOARD_PART_NUMBER string default "DK8X" - depends on BOARD_IWILL_DK8X config HW_MEM_HOLE_SIZEK hex default 0x100000 - depends on BOARD_IWILL_DK8X config MAX_CPUS int default 2 - depends on BOARD_IWILL_DK8X config MAX_PHYSICAL_CPUS int default 2 - depends on BOARD_IWILL_DK8X config HW_MEM_HOLE_SIZE_AUTO_INC bool default n - depends on BOARD_IWILL_DK8X config SB_HT_CHAIN_ON_BUS0 int default 0 - depends on BOARD_IWILL_DK8X config HT_CHAIN_END_UNITID_BASE hex default 0x20 - depends on BOARD_IWILL_DK8X config HT_CHAIN_UNITID_BASE hex default 0x1 - depends on BOARD_IWILL_DK8X config SERIAL_CPU_INIT bool default n - depends on BOARD_IWILL_DK8X config IRQ_SLOT_COUNT int default 9 - depends on BOARD_IWILL_DK8X + +endif # BOARD_IWILL_DK8X |